Abstract
The utility model is applicable to the technical field of lightning protection, and provides a photovoltaic frame with a lightning protection function, which comprises a photovoltaic frame and a solar panel arranged in the photovoltaic frame, wherein a lightning protection guide piece is clamped on the photovoltaic frame; the lightning protection guide piece comprises an upper L-shaped clamping piece and a lower L-shaped clamping piece, a sliding groove matched with the upper L-shaped clamping piece is formed in the long side of the lower L-shaped clamping piece, and a limiting sliding strip matched with the sliding groove is arranged on the long side of the upper L-shaped clamping piece; rubber strips are clamped on the opposite surfaces of the short sides of the upper L-shaped clamping piece and the lower L-shaped clamping piece. According to the utility model, the upper L-shaped clamping piece and the lower L-shaped clamping piece are tightly connected with the photovoltaic frame, the lightning is guided to the ground by the conductive strips, so that the frame is guaranteed to have an efficient lightning protection effect, the lightning protection guiding piece is clamped at the outer side of the photovoltaic frame, and the lightning protection guiding piece is easy to install, maintain and replace by penetrating through the fastening bolts of the upper L-shaped clamping piece and the lower L-shaped clamping piece.

Background
At present, light Fu Biankuang on the market is completely cut and assembled on site from the beginning to aluminum alloy brackets which are later developed into various forms, the brackets are reasonable in design and convenient to install, and become a mature industry, however, the frame of the photovoltaic module is made of aluminum alloy materials and is subjected to surface anodic oxidation treatment, after the brackets are connected with the module, lightning protection grounding is generally only carried out on the brackets, two modules are connected to form a passage after connecting terminals are arranged at two ends of a grounding wire to make the lightning protection grounding for the module, and the brackets are connected with roof grounding strips, so that the construction method is complex in procedure and wastes materials and labor; by installing the grounding wire on the photovoltaic support for grounding, however, the effect of the gap or the oxide layer between the photovoltaic frame and the support can affect the conductive effect, so that the lightning protection effect is insufficient.
The photovoltaic frame lightning protection construction method is complex in working procedure, wastes materials and labor, and is easy to cause poor wire effect and insufficient lightning protection effect due to oxidation.
Disclosure of Invention
Aiming at the defects in the prior art, the utility model aims to provide the lightning protection guide piece which can be clamped on the photovoltaic frame, lightning is guided at the periphery of the photovoltaic frame, and the grounding point of the photovoltaic frame is increased, so that the lightning protection effect of the photovoltaic frame is improved.

The working principle of the photovoltaic frame with the lightning protection function provided by the utility model is as follows:
during use, the upper L-shaped clamping piece 301 and the lower L-shaped clamping piece 302 are clamped on the photovoltaic frame 1, so that the rubber strip 4 is in contact with the solar panel 2 and the bottom of the photovoltaic frame 1 (a height difference exists between the upper edge top surface of the photovoltaic frame and glass on the photovoltaic assembly, the rubber strip 4 can be clamped between the upper edge top surface and the glass on the photovoltaic assembly, the installation stability of the lightning protection guide piece 3 is improved), the power generation assembly is prevented from being scratched by metal contact, the damage to the photovoltaic power generation assembly is reduced, then the upper L-shaped clamping piece 301 and the lower L-shaped clamping piece 302 are clamped together by using a fastening bolt, the upper extension plate 305 and the lower extension plate 306 penetrate through the conductive strip 6, one end of the conductive strip 6 is grounded, and the installation can be completed, the operation is simple, and the maintenance and the replacement are convenient.
Example two
On the basis of the first embodiment, the present embodiment is different in that:
referring to fig. 10 and 11, a tip lightning guiding structure 7 is fixed on top of the upper L-shaped clip 301. The tip lightning guiding structure 7 comprises a connecting seat 701 fixedly connected with the upper L-shaped clamping piece 301, an extension column 702 is fixed at the bottom end of the connecting seat 701, and a lightning guiding ring 703 is fixed at the top of the connecting seat 701; the lightning rod 704 with the conical top end is fixed at the top of the connecting seat 701 and the center of the lightning rod 703, and the top tip of the lightning rod 704 is flush with the top end surface of the lightning rod 703 or lower than the top end surface of the lightning rod 703 by 0.5cm-1cm, so that the damage to personnel caused by excessive protrusion of the tip is avoided.
The top of the upper L-shaped clamping piece 301 is fixed with a mounting sleeve 307 matched with the connecting seat 701, and a groove 308 matched with the extension column 702 is formed in the center of the bottom of the mounting sleeve 307 and positioned at the top of the upper L-shaped clamping piece 301. Through the tip lightning guiding structure 7 that sets up, can be through surpassing the high first and thunder and lightning contact of lightning guide 3 when taking place the thunderbolt, guide the thunder and lightning, avoid the thunder and lightning directly to act on solar cell panel 2, improve the protection effect to solar cell panel 2.
